I need a coil for a 262. The coil from any of the folloing will work:
Husqvarna: 50, 51, 55, 254, 154, 257, 261, 262, 40, 45, 49, 268, 272 Jonsered: 490, 590, 2050, 2045, 2041, 2051, 2054, 2055, 670Partner: 500, 5000, 540,
